Output f672fbd40c1d0769e60d71137a443be054b57b9c15405a5e6db64ca1e1bc8285:0

value
590688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d887c46768be55a619484a069945f1a24e80bec5 OP_EQUAL
address
2NCz8azNU5zXtjxrdygSS5DbghJRs4K8ksJ
transaction
f672fbd40c1d0769e60d71137a443be054b57b9c15405a5e6db64ca1e1bc8285
confirmations
78005
spent
true